Method
- Drain the canned tuna completely to remove excess water. Transfer to a medium bowl and flake thoroughly with a fork.
- Add the light mayonnaise, lemon juice, diced celery, minced red onion, salt, and pepper to the flaked tuna.
- Stir the mixture gently until all ingredients are well combined and the tuna is evenly coated. Adjust seasoning to taste. Set aside.
- Brush one side of each sourdough slice lightly with olive oil or butter.
- Heat a skillet over medium heat. Toast the bread, oiled side down, for 2-3 minutes until golden and crispy.
- Place two slices of toasted bread on a board. Layer a generous amount of arugula on the bottom slices.
- Scoop the prepared tuna salad evenly over the arugula layer.
- Top with remaining bread slices, press gently, slice in half, and serve immediately.
Notes
To avoid a soggy sandwich if making ahead for work, pack the toasted bread, tuna salad, and arugula in separate containers and assemble right before eating.
